The Department of Foreign Relations under the Ministry of Public Security (MPS) in collaboration with the US Embassy in Vietnam has just opened an English training course for the officers of the MPS.
This program is in the framework of the Letter of Agreement (LOA) on law enforcement and criminal justice assistance between the two countries, which was signed in May 2016 during the official visit of the then US President Barack Obama to Vietnam.The LOA covers projects to improve the capacity of Vietnamese law enforcement forces to conduct evidence-based investigations, ensure security and safety for citizens, and prevent and combat transnational crime and other types of crime.
The training course aims to provide trainees with English used in law enforcement sector. The course-book is the “English for Law Enforcement” published by the UK Education Group MacMillian, which is widely used in English training courses for law enforcement forces in many countries around the world.
